Where in Spain is the warmest in December?

With an average high of 72°F (22°C), Gran Canaria is the hottest part of Spain in December. This island features a striking mix of black and white sand beaches, popular for both swimming and surfing. In fact, winter marks the high season for surfing.

In December, the coast of Levante (Spain's eastern coast) and the south typically have mostly sunny days with mild temperatures. The average daily temperature in southern Andalusia in December is 55º F (13º C). Alicante, in the east, registers an even warmer average daily temp of 57º F (14º C).

What is the hottest part of Spain in December? In December, the Canary Islands, located off the northwest coast of Africa, experience the hottest temperatures in Spain. Tenerife and Lanzarote, among the Canary Islands, offer warm and sunny conditions with average high temperatures of 21°C to 22°C (70°F to 72°F).

Gran Canaria gets its hot weather being so close to the Sahara Desert, although winds and the cool Canary Current keep things comfortable in December. Although it's winter, you'll still be able to lounge around in your beach gear all day, as Gran Canaria has an average high temperature of 22ºC in December.

Winter in Malta is mild, making it a popular choice to escape the cold weather for some winter sun. The temperatures in December are around 17 °C, whilst January and February are only slightly cooler- at about 15 °C. Winter is also the wettest time of the year with the average rainfall at 90 mm.
